Raymond Frank Estrella, Sr. March 05, 1927 – May 05, 2019 Share this obituary Send Flowers Send Sympathy Card Raymond Frank Estrella, Sr., 92, of Hilo died May 5 at the Hawaii Care Choices Pohai Malama Care Center. Born in Hilo, he was a retired office clerk for the County of Hawaii South Hilo Road Department, member of St. Joseph Catholic Church, Our Mother of Perpetual Help Novena, Pu’u Wai O Pio Senior Baseball Team and a veteran and Corporal with the U.S. Army during World War II and receiving the World War II Victory Medal and Philippines Independence Metal. Friends may call 5–6:30 p.m. Thursday (May 23, 2019) at Dodo Mortuary Chapel; wake service at 6:30.

Friends may call again 9–10:30 a.m. Friday (May 24, 2019) at St. Joseph Catholic Church in Hilo; funeral mass at 10:30. Burial to follow at Hawaii Veterans Cemetery #2. Casual attire.

Survived by daughters, Annette (Douglas) Arruda of Keaau, Emily (Greg) Ascino of Kona; son, Ray (Julianna) C. Estrella of Kona; sons-in-law, Edward Kansana of Hilo, Joseph Ragocos, Sr. of Hilo; private nurse, Merry Kranz of Mountain View; 14 grandchildren, 20 great-grandchildren, two great-great-grandchildren, numerous nieces & nephews.
